This notice is a combined synopsis/solicitation for commercial items prepared inaccordance with the format in FAR Subpart 12.6, as supplemented with additionalinformation included in this notice. This announcement constitutes the onlysolicitation, which is issued as a Request for Quotation (RFQ); quotes are beingrequested and a written solicitation will not be issued. NASA/KSC has a requirement for multiple RF Amplifiers and additional hardware asdescribed in the attached SF1449.All units will be shipped to the address below:Transportation OfficerNASA / Kennedy Space CenterJ-BOSC WAREHOUSE, BUILDING M6-744KENNEDY SPACE CENTER, FL 32899The Government intends to acquire a commercial item using FAR Part 12 and the SimplifiedAcquisition Procedures set forth in FAR Part 13.This procurement is a total small business set-aside. See Note 1. The NAICS Code and the small business size standard for this procurement are 334220/750employees respectively. The offeror shall state in their offer their size status for thisprocurementAll responsible sources may submit an offer which shall be considered by the agency. Questions regarding this acquisition must be in writing, via e-mail, to Erik C. Whitehillnot later than close of business (COB) July 9, 2008. Telephone questions will not beaccepted. It is the quoter's responsibility to monitor this site for the release ofamendments (if any). Potential quoters will be responsible for downloading their owncopy of this notice, the on-line RFQ and amendments (if any).Selection and award will be made to that offeror whose offer is the lowest pricetechnically acceptable source. It is critical that offerors provide adequate detail toallow evaluation of their offer. (SEE FAR 52.212-1(b)). Offers for the items(s) described above are due by COB July 17, 2008, to NASA-KSC, Attn:Erik C. Whitehill, e-mail: Erik C. Whitehill@nasa.gov and must include, solicitationnumber, FOB destination to KSC, proposed delivery schedule, discount/payment terms,warranty duration (if applicable), taxpayer identification number (TIN), identificationof any special commercial terms, and be signed by an authorized company representative. Offerors shall provide the information required by FAR 52.212-1 (JAN 2006), Instructionsto Offerors-Commercial, which is incorporated by reference. If the end product(s) offered is other than domestic end product(s) as defined in theclause entitled "Buy American Act -- Supplies," the offeror shall so state and shall listthe country of origin. FAR 52.212-4 (FEB 2007), Contract Terms and Conditions-Commercial Items is applicable. FAR 52.212-5 (NOV 2007), Contract Terms and Conditions Required To Implement Statutes orExecutive Orders-Commercial Items is applicable and the following identified clauses areincorporated by reference: FAR 52.233-3 Protest after Award (AUG 1996) (31 USC 3553) FAR 52.233-4, Applicable Law for Breach of Contract Claim (OCT 2004) (Pub.L. 108-77,108-78) The Contractor shall comply with the FAR clauses in this paragraph that the contractingOfficer has indicated as being incorporated in the contract by reference to implementprovisions of law or Executive Orders applicable to acquisitions of commercial items: 52.222-3, Convict Labor (JUN 2003) (E.O. 11755). 52.222-19, Child Labor-Cooperation with Authorities and Remedies (AUG 2007) (E.O. 13126)52.222-21, Prohibition of Segregated Facilities (FEB 1999) 52.222-26, Equal Opportunity (MAR 2007) (E.O. 11246) 52.222-35, Equal Opportunity for Special Disabled Veterans, Veterans of the Vietnam Era,and Other Eligible Veterans (SEP 2006) (38 USC 4212) 52.222-36, Affirmative Action for Workers with Disabilities (Jun 1998) (29 USC 793) 52.222-37, Employment Reports on Special Disabled Veterans, Veterans of the Vietnam Era,and Other Eligible Veterans (SEP 2006) (38 USC 4212)52.225-1, Buy American Act-Supplies (JUN 2003) (41 USC 10a-10d) 52.225-13, Restrictions on Certain Foreign Purchases (FEB 2006) (EOS, proclamations, andstatutes administered by the Office of Foreign Assets Control of the Department of theTreasury.) 52.232-34, Payment by Electronic Funds Transfer- Central ContractorRegistration (OCT 2003) (31 USC 3332). Offerors must include completed copies of the provision at 52.212-3, OfferorRepresentations and Certifications - Commercial Items with their offer.
